Picking the right contractor is critical for the result of your task. Here’s a structured technique:
1. Specify Your Project’s Scope
Before looking for a contractor, it’s necessary to have a clear understanding of your job. Think about the following:
What kind of task is it? (e.g., remodel, repair, addition)What is your spending plan?What is your timeline?2. Research and Gather Referrals
Ask buddies, family, and associates for suggestions. Websites and social networks platforms can also supply important insights into reliable contractors.
3. Inspect Credentials and Reviews
Examine possible contractors based upon the following criteria:
Licensing: Ensure the contractor holds the necessary licenses for your specific project.Insurance: Verify that the contractor has both liability insurance coverage and employee’s payment coverage.Evaluations: Look up consumer evaluations on reliable platforms to evaluate their performance and dependability.4. Interview Potential Contractors
When you have a shortlist, conduct interviews to evaluate their personalities and competence. Ask the following questions:
What is your experience with jobs similar to mine?Can you offer referrals or previous project photographs?What is your approximated timeline for completion?How do you handle unforeseen issues throughout a job?5. Get Multiple Estimates
Demand written estimates from a minimum of 3 contractors. This will assist you examine the market rate and better comprehend what to anticipate regarding expenses.
6. Evaluation Contracts Carefully
Before signing any contract, ensure that it consists of:

How do I know if I need a contractor or if I can do the job myself?
Think about the intricacy of the project. If it needs specialized abilities, allows, or substantial labor, it might be best to hire a contractor.
2. Just how much should I anticipate to pay for a contractor?
Prices vary based on the project size, contractor’s experience, and area. On average, expect to pay in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 per hour, depending upon these factors.
3. What are some red flags to look for when working with a contractor?
Beware of contractors who ask for large in advance payments, lack appropriate licensing or insurance coverage, or have poor reviews.
4. How long does it normally require to complete a home improvement job?
Task timelines depend on the scale of work. Small projects may take a few days, while major renovations can take months.
5. Is it required to be in the house throughout the task?
While not vital, it is typically beneficial to be available for communication and to address any immediate issues that may emerge.
